Oligario Ortega, 92, of Amalia passed away on June 12, 2009. Mr. Ortega retired from Taos County as a heavy equipment operator and he was a WW II Army veteran who served in the European Theater. He was preceded in death by his wife Donelia Ortega. He is survived by his sons Donald and Ricky Ortega (Margie) both of Denver, daughters Miquela Griego (John) of Bernalillo, Reyecita Ortega, of Denver, Louise Archuleta (Joseph) of Colorado Springs and Dolores Lucero (Steve) of Amalia and two grandchildren that he raised Christie Gurule (Gerald) of San Luis, and Donna Ortega of Colorado Springs. He is also survived by brothers Fred Ortega and George Ortega (Cora Lee), sisters Alice Martinez (Telesfor), Evangeline Leyba, Lillian Torres, fifteen grandchildren and seventeen great-grandchildren.

Evening service will be held on Tuesday, June 16, 2009 at 7 pm at Abundant Life Christian Fellowship Church in Amalia. Funeral service will be held on Wednesday, June 17, 2009 at 10 AM at Abundant Life Christian Fellowship Church with interment to follow with full military honors at the Amalia Cemetery.
